Key Areas of Responsibility
Logistics and Preparation
• Receiving and fulfilling practical requisitions received from the Science teaching team.
• Delivering equipment to laboratories and collecting, checking and returning equipment to stores.
• Taking care of equipment and apparatus, including cleaning, maintenance and repair.
• General laboratory cleaning (bench surfaces and fixed equipment including sinks).
• Organising and maintaining laboratory stored equipment and resources.
• Organising, storing, stocktaking and ordering of chemicals and equipment.
• Disposing of waste materials.
• Making up solutions.
• Constructing, modifying and assembling apparatus.
• Participating in department meetings.
Health and Safety
• Carrying out risk assessments for all planned practical activities.
• Keeping up to date with health & safety requirements.
• Carrying out health & safety checks on laboratories, prep rooms and stores and making necessary recommendations and adjustments.
• Carrying out safety checks, which may include electrical equipment, fume cupboards, first-aid kits, pressure vessels and the condition of Bunsen burner tubing, eye protection, glassware, and chemicals that deteriorate.
• Attend and contribute to regular training and assessment as required.
Teaching and Learning
• Photocopying and laminating teaching resources required by Science teaching team.
• Ensuring all teaching and practical resources required by teaching staff are delivered on time with the correct numbers.
• Discussing and trailing practical activities with teachers if necessary.
• Providing technical support to experienced and trainee teachers including health & safety guidance.
• Providing technical support to students, including health & safety guidance.
• Assisting in practical classes as required.
• Carrying out and maintaining a high standard of display in the Science department.
• Ensuring the delivery of practical and teaching resources for extra-curricular activities such as field trips and science clubs.
